Overview
The Heat Treat Technician is responsible for performing post-weld heat treatment (PWHT) and thermal processing in support of nondestructive testing (NDT) operations. This role ensures materials meet required mechanical properties and industry codes through controlled heating and cooling processes while maintaining compliance with safety, quality, and customer standards.
Major Responsibilities/Activities- Perform preheat, post-weld heat treatment (PWHT), bake-outs, and stress-relief processes per procedures and specifications
- Set up, operate, and monitor heat treatment equipment including resistance heaters, induction systems, and thermocouples
- Install and remove thermocouples, insulation, and heating elements
- Interpret heat treatment procedures, drawings, and customer specifications
- Monitor temperature cycles and document heat treatment charts and reports
- Support NDT inspections by ensuring components meet required metallurgical conditions
- Verify equipment calibration and maintain heat treatment records
- Follow safety procedures, including hot work and confined space requirements
- Work collaboratively with welders, inspectors, and quality personnel
- Maintain clean and organized work areas and equipment
- High school diploma or GED required
- 2+ years of experience in industrial heat treatment, PWHT, or related field
- Knowledge of heat treatment processes and metallurgy fundamentals
- Ability to read and interpret heat treatment procedures and technical drawings
- Familiarity with ASME, AWS, and customer heat treatment specifications
-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and work in industrial environments
- Heat Treat Technician certification or formal technical training
- Experience supporting NDT inspections in refinery, power plant, pipeline, or fabrication environments
- Knowledge of thermocouple placement, chart recorders, and data logging systems
